Pre-Operative Preparation



Prior to undergoing cataract surgery, your ophthalmologist will certainly give you with thorough instructions for pre-operative preparation. These guidelines might consist of standards on fasting before the surgical procedure, as well as details on any kind of medicines you ought to readjust or proceed taking. It's critical to follow these instructions meticulously to make sure the procedure goes efficiently and your recuperation succeeds.

Additionally, your medical professional might suggest you to schedule transportation to and from the surgical center, as you will not be able to drive quickly after the procedure. Make sure to have a liable adult accompany you on the day of surgery to provide support and help.

Sometimes, you may require to go through certain pre-operative tests to evaluate your eye health and make sure the surgical procedure can continue as intended. These tests might include determining the sizes and shape of your eye, looking for any type of hidden conditions, and evaluating your general health to minimize any risks associated with the procedure.

Surgery Introduction



When undertaking cataract surgery, the surgery normally entails removing the gloomy lens and replacing it with a clear man-made lens to recover vision. This treatment is performed under regional anesthesia, suggesting you'll be awake yet your eye will be numbed to prevent any type of discomfort.

The doctor will make a tiny cut in your eye and usage ultrasound modern technology to break up the over cast lens, which is then carefully sucked out. Once the cataract is removed, an intraocular lens (IOL) is placed right into the very same pill that held your natural lens. This IOL stays in location permanently and does not call for any kind of maintenance.

The whole surgery generally takes around 15-30 mins per eye, and you can commonly go home the same day. It is very important to follow your specialist's post-operative guidelines carefully to make certain correct recovery and ideal visual outcomes.

Post-Operative Recuperation



After cataract surgery, you'll be recommended on exactly how to look after your eye during the post-operative healing period. It's critical to comply with these directions vigilantly to guarantee a smooth recovery process. Your eye may be covered with a safety guard or patch right away after the surgery to avoid any type of accidental rubbing or pressure on the run eye. You might also need to utilize prescribed eye goes down to aid in recovery and stop infection.

During the initial healing period, you might experience some mild discomfort, itching, or watering of the eye, which is regular. It's important to prevent laborious activities, flexing over, or raising heavy challenge protect against any kind of stress on the eye. You must also go to follow-up consultations with your eye doctor to check your development and address any kind of concerns.

As your eye continues to heal over the following weeks, your vision will gradually boost. It's necessary to be patient during this recovery duration and permit your eye to fully heal prior to returning to typical activities. If you experience any kind of sudden changes in vision, extreme discomfort, or various other worrying symptoms, contact your eye doctor instantly for additional assessment.
